Biography
She has recurring roles as Tim Allen's inept producer on ABC's "Home Improvement" and as Jason Alexander's bane-of-my-existence secretary on NBC's "Seinfeld" before landing the regular stint as Beth, the secretary from Smart Aleck 101, on "NewsRadio" (NBC, 1995-99).

Career Milestones
| Played Beth the secretary on "NewsRadio" | ||
1982 | Co-starred in musical, "Do Black Patent Leather Shoes Really Reflect Up?" | |
1985 | Co-starred with Nathan Lane in the short-lived Broadway musical "The Wind in the Willows" | |
1985 | Early TV role, Schoolbreak Special, "The Day the Senior Class Got Married" | |
1988 | First episodic guest appearance, "Annie McGuire" | |
1992 | Played recurring role of Maureen Binford, producer of "Home Improvement" (ABC) | |
1994 | Appeared in Broadway revival of "Damn Yankees" | |
1994 | Feature film debut, "I'll Do Anything" | |
1994 | Had recurring role as Ada, George's secretary on "Seinfeld" (NBC) | |
1997 | Co-starred opposite Nathan Lane in "Mousehunt" | |
1998 | Had featured role as a paleontologist in "Godzilla" | |
1999 | Appeared opposite off-screen companion Nick Nolte in "Breakfast of Champions" | |
1999 | Played Velma Kelly in the national tour of the stage musical "Chicago"; assumed role on Broadway in summer 2000 | |
2001 | Co-starred in the NBC midseason replacement sitcom "Three Sisters" | |
2001 | Returned to Broadway playing Velma in the hit revival of "Chicago" | |
2009 | Landed a recurring role on the Disney Channel comedy series "Sonny with a Chance" | |
2009 | Played a saleswoman in the romantic comedy, "The Ugly Truth" | |
2010 | Voiced the character of Eve in the animated feature, "Alpha and Omega" | |
